Brief history

Radiology has been around for over a century. It all started when Wilhelm Conrad Rontgen discovered x-rays in 1895. After working for weeks in his lab experimenting the production of "strange Rays" which he referred to as "X" , he asked his wife Anna bertha to lend a hand, the left to be precise, which he used to produce the first x-ray image. This phenomenon a great deal of interest all over the world. Within weeks of his announcement, hospitals world-wide had taken the initiative to open up x-ray rooms which gave rise to the radiology department.

Radiography

Radiography studies the application of various forms of radiant energies and waveforms to promote health and treat diseases in human beings. In this application, various diagnostic images like X-rays, Ultrasound, Radionuclides, Thermography and Magnetic Resonance Imaging are produced.

One who is educationally trained and professionally qualified to practice any or all of the above named imagings is called a Radiographer or an Imaging Scientist. The practice of Radiography is divided into two viz: Diagnostic and Therapeutic Radiography.

In practice, Diagnostic Radiographers use imaging modalities like conventional X-rays - which is a machine used to visualize body tissues, bones, cavities and foreign bodies in any part of the body.
Fluoroscopy is used to study some the functions of some internal organs of the body.
Computed Tomography (CT) is used to provide detailed views of the body's soft tissues including blood vessels and organs.
Magnetic Resonance Imaging (MRI) produces maps of biochemical compounds within the body. The maps produce anatomical and biomedical information.

Therapy Radiographers are practically involved in the treatment of diseases. The use ionizing radiation mainly to treat patients who have cancer. It is the duty of the therapy Radiographer (Radiotherapist) to establish the location of the diseased part of the body that needs treatment and work out the exact dose of the ionizing radiation required for treatment.

Note: we also have industrial Radiographers

Every 8th November, is regarded as world Radiography day, where this great profession is celebrated and people are enlightened about what the profession is all about
